Pima County Board of Supervisors Nixes 2010 Bond Election

Posted By on Tue, Feb 2, 2010 at 10:37 AM

Citing the lousy economy, the Pima County Board of Supervisors has voted 4-1 to scrap the idea of a bond election this November.

Supervisor Richard Elias was the lone vote against the motion, arguing that the county needed additional dollars for community amenities.
